The easiest way would be a third NNID account for Austria because they have the same currency and eShop cards as Germany.
(My second account is a UK NNID, which I thought would function as well but it doesn't because it's using £ instead of €.)
I got some codes from games that are not available in Germany, like Master Reboot, Gravity Badgers, Ittle Dew, Roving Rogue, Word Party, and Paper Monsters Recut. As long as it's free I can download it from the UK eShop.

Plus, I'm afraid to lose games I bought from a different region or with a NNID if there's a software transfer to NX.
On WiiWare I lost Toribash in the transfer to Wii U because I downloaded it from a different region.
